Abstract
A deflection prism assembly for an endoscope having a lateral viewing direction, the deflection prism assembly including: a prism holder; and a deflection prism accommodated in the prism holder; wherein the deflection prism has a light outlet surface and an opposite light inlet surface arranged obliquely to the light outlet surface, the deflection prism further having a lateral surface extending between the light inlet surface and the light outlet surface; and the prism holder accommodates the deflection prism such that the prism holder surrounds less than all regions of the lateral surface of the deflection prism.

(17) For fixing purposes, the deflection prism 22b has bottom surfaces 29a, 29b, 29c on the lower side, of which only the bottom surface 29b is visible in the longitudinal section shown in
(18) The second part 30b of the prism holder 31 has an upper holding surface 32. This has a complementary shape to the reflection surface 28a and is fixed to the latter, for example with a suitable adhesive. Between the upper holding surface 32 and the reflection surface 28a there is located an adhesive gap 35.
(19) In order to align the deflection prism 22d, a region of the light outlet surface 27 rests on a contact surface 33 of the stop 30c. In this way, a tilting of the deflection prism 32 is minimized or even excluded.

(21) In order to make it possible to center the deflection prism 22d exactly, the lateral surface 23 is circular in the part of the outer circumference, which is not enclosed. In the case of the example shown in
(22) On the underside, the deflection prism 22d has three bottom surfaces 29a, 29b, 29c which have a complementary shape to the lower holding surfaces 34a, 34b, 34c of the prism holder 31. Between the bottom surfaces 29a, 29b, 29c and the holding surfaces 34a, 34b, 34c there is located the adhesive gap 35 for this purpose.
(23) In order to protect the deflection prism 22d from slipping under the action of shear forces, the bottom surfaces 29a, 29b, 29c can be arranged at a total angle α of approximately 90°. That is to say, the total of the angles of the adjacent lower holding surfaces 34a, 34b, 34c is approximately 90°. This embodiment is a compromise between the resistance to shear forces and the possibility of centering the deflection prism 22d.
